Urban Awesome Street Podcast Ep 04 : Michael Ernest Sweet
Welcome to the 4th instalment of the UrbanAwesome Street Photography Podcast.
In this edition, I talk to New York based street photographer Michael Ernest Sweet about his books, his art and what makes him tick as an artist.
Michael is an award-winning writer and photographer.
His photographs have appeared in Popular Photography, Black and White Magazine and in Digital Camera Magazine among others.

Urban Awesome Street Photography Podcast Ep03 : Sally Davies
Welcome to the 3rd instalment of the UrbanAwesome Street Photography Podcast.
In this edition, I talk to New York street photographer Sally Davies about her unique photographic style, her process and approach to her very unique work.
Her art has been featured on HBO's "Sex and the City", Ted Demme's film "200 Cigarettes", and her Lucky Chairs have been featured on the Oprah Winfrey Show and "Sex and the City."
In this Sally offers some really great advice and her frank approach to her art.
